This is a combination chemotherapy regimen consisting of four agents: - **5-fluorouracil (5-FU):** A pyrimidine analog antimetabolite that inhibits thymidylate synthase, disrupting DNA synthesis and leading to cell death in rapidly dividing cells. - **Mitomycin C:** An alkylating agent that crosslinks DNA, inhibiting DNA synthesis and function. - **Tegafur:** A prodrug of 5-FU, metabolized primarily in the liver to release active 5-FU gradually. This allows for oral administration and sustained systemic exposure. - **Uracil:** Included as a biochemical modulator; it competitively inhibits dihydropyrimidine dehydrogenase (DPD), the enzyme responsible for degrading 5-FU, thereby increasing and prolonging systemic levels of active 5-FU. The combination leverages multiple mechanisms to enhance antitumor efficacy. Tegafur/uracil (often known as UFT) is widely used in Japan for various cancers due to its oral bioavailability and ability to maintain therapeutic concentrations of 5-FU[1][4][6]. Mitomycin C adds an additional cytotoxic mechanism via DNA crosslinking. The full four-drug combination has been reported in case studies or clinical settings for advanced gastrointestinal cancers such as gastric cancer[3], though more commonly combinations like UFT plus mitomycin C are described.
